> On 4/11/2014 10:29, David Carlson wrote:
>> Peter and Ken, I noticed that in Windows, release 2.4.13 the spacebar
>> does automatically advance the selection as you described, and
>> release 2.6.4 October 22 Windows build it does not advance, as you
>> also describe. Release 2.6.3 spacebar does not advance the selection
>> in Ubuntu 12.04 either. I think that could be called an inadvertent
>> regression. The Tutorial description of Entry Shortcuts describes
>> using the spacebar in the reconcile window, but it does not say
>> whether the selection advances automatically in either the 2.4 Guide
>> or the 2.6 guide. I would consider filing a bug report, and I would
>> like to have a preference setting so that either action could be
>> chosen. David C _______________________________________________

I have filed *Bug 739601*
<https://bugzilla.gnome.org/show_bug.cgi?id=739601> to request
restoration of the previous behavior.  I found that another bug resolved
in release 2.6.1 may have caused this change and that change may make it
difficult to fix this behavior.  We shall see whether the gods will look
favorably on this request.
